Transaction 62b510d3b06bb124ed2d02b0584df437a1aae81edf62b158a6d7026bfc8a7a56
1 Input
1 Output
-
62b510d3b06bb124ed2d02b0584df437a1aae81edf62b158a6d7026bfc8a7a56:0
- value
- 354403
- script pubkey
- OP_0 OP_PUSHBYTES_20 a10ada95a857e531618d10c8c1a733900dd21b69
- address
- bc1q5y9d49dg2ljnzcvdzryvrfenjqxayxmf2tc06y